A symbol operand (constraint "s") feeds a function/global symbol whose mangled name the template emits — enabling a DIRECT `bl %[fn]` (one fewer indirection than register-indirect `blr`). Until now `"s" = fn` fell through to emit and produced an LLVM-verifier crash (param type mismatch). Reject it at lowering with a clear diagnostic instead, and lock that with examples/1656-platform-asm-symbol-operand.sx. The next commit implements it and flips the example to run (→ 42).
